Prerequisites for Effective Prayer

Three key prerequisites for prayer are humility, love, and faith. ​

Five Purposes of Prayer

Prayer serves five primary purposes: adoration, thanksgiving, repentance, intercession, and petition. ​

Different Expressions of Prayer

Christian tradition recognizes three major expressions of prayer: vocal, meditative, and contemplative. ​
